Output 3843acf61cb93d5d5b6bce76736e73cd067812b955e92ecc30d14224d353ef0e:57

value
4551965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90ccd72e2cbfdb2f5b13bc0ad30ee705ef3d6ac0 OP_EQUAL
address
3EtecjmNfxYvrtEd7pftiQs1FPcAYneLWg
transaction
3843acf61cb93d5d5b6bce76736e73cd067812b955e92ecc30d14224d353ef0e
spent
true